Dak Prescott is a good QB. He’s had a tough go of it this year with huge losses on the offensive line in the offseason, a poor WR corp (other than Lamb), mediocre TE targets and an anemic RB corp. There is not a QB — other than Patrick Mahomes — who would have a prayer of winning with this group. And even he would struggle to carry this team to 9-8.

Last year the Cowboys were top 10 — maybe even top 5 — in overall talent, but injuries, a mediocre last two drafts, free agency losses, and zero good pickups in free agency or trades has dropped them to the bottom half of the NFL virtually overnight.
